Before we are able to find ways in which to combat sound pollution, we need to understand exactly how sound travels and is transmitted.

There are only a couple of ways in which sound can travel around a home:

1. Through the air by vibration of air molecules.

2. Through objects by the vibration of the material.

As dolphin and whale song shows, sound also travels through water, but unless you wish to soundproof an aquarium or swimming pool we will look only at the methods of soundproofing structures and rooms.

SOUND THROUGH THE AIR

Significant amounts of sound can be transferred into and out of a room through open air-ducting, gaps around doors, ill fitted windows and even electrical sockets and light fittings. What we hear and identify as sound is actually the vibration of air molecules being picked up by our ear drums. All sounds travel through the air in this same manner; it doesn't matter if it's busy traffic, passing aircraft, machinery, music or kids playing that creates the sound.

It is helpful to visualise your room as a boat and carefully inspect it for leaks that need to be plugged before you can dare to sail it.

SOUND TRAVEL THROUGH OBJECTS AND STRUCTURES

Sound waves can also be transferred to, absorbed by or reflected by solid objects and structures. The ceilings, floors and walls will all have an effect on how sound travels around a room, and may even transport that vibration to other areas of a property. Even in a room that's built from a solid material that's proofed against vibrations, such as a concrete lined basement, the sound can be reflected and perhaps even amplified to other rooms in the structure.

BASIC STEPS IN SOUNDPROOFING

Consider covering bare floors, which resonate and reflect sound, with a rug or carpet. The rugs or other soft coverings will help to soak up sounds but can also add a bit of style to an otherwise bare room. Curtains, in particular heavy blackout types, will also subdue any sounds from invading or escaping the area, cost-effectively and without the need for professional soundproofing.

Another economical and do-it-yourself resolution is to plug any holes around windows, electrical sockets, doors and light fittings. You can find professional acoustic sealants in some builders merchants that deaden the transmission of sound by absorbing the sound waves. Acoustic sealants can be a touch more pricey than regular sealant products, but their outstanding soundproofing qualities far outweigh the small additional cost.

If your room is a blank canvas and you are soundproofing while you decorate or renovate, consider installing a skin of soundboard or plasterboard, (also called drywall, sheet rock or gypsum board). This is a fairly dense type of boarding which is a perfect and economic soundproofing material. It is superb if you are installing a music studio, home cinema or study in your property in Plymouth. Lastly you should inspect all doors in the rooms that you're soundproofing. Hollow doors are reasonably cheap but their soundproofing qualities are a far cry from perfect. If you are able to change to solid doors you'll discover that it improves your soundproofing more cheaply than some other options.

PROFESSIONAL SOUNDPROOFING OF CEILINGS, FLOORS and WALLS

There are 2 areas that need to be addressed to soundproof any space:

  1. Reduce sound amplifying and reverberation.
  2. Increase the absorption of sound.

A site survey is going to be required to assess the areas that need to be improved.

The team will work out ways of adding materials that have different masses and densities to improve the sound quality of the room. The use of acoustic foams and rubbers of different density and mass will help in absorbing sounds and reduce reflections and transmission sources.

Voids between joists might need insulation to eliminate the resonating space between them. If you visualise these spaces like a drum or wooden cajon then you can see that by leaving wall cavities and floor or ceiling joist spaces empty, you're effectively creating a noise amplifying area.

Soundproofing is improved if multiple layers of varying density materials are utilised, as opposed to installing a single sort of material. This is due to the fact that the different material densities react in different ways with varying frequencies and will provide a better solution to your soundproofing exploits.

Any soundproofing installer in Plymouth will have to follow the Part E of the Building Regulations, if dealing with a residential property. This set of regulations is a requirement in law to protect yourself and neighbours from the effects of sound pollution in an environment where folks work and live.

Grants for Soundproofing

Soundproofing Grants Plymouth

In the past there have been grants available for assistance with soundproofing in areas of excessive noise. The Highways Agency recently offered grants for locations beside busy roads and highways where homes were impacted by traffic noise. It is recommended that you check out the Government portal for current compensation schemes and grants to find out whether you are entitled to any assistance with your soundproofing costs in Plymouth.
